What is 50/46 Divided By 8/4

Answer: 5046÷84\frac{50}{46}\div\frac{8}{4} = 2546\frac{25}{46}

Solving 5046÷84\frac{50}{46}\div\frac{8}{4}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

5046÷84=5046×48\frac{50}{46} \div \frac{8}{4} = \frac{50}{46} \times \frac{4}{8}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 50×4=20050 \times 4 = 200
  • Multiply the Denominators: 46×8=36846 \times 8 = 368
  • Form the New Fraction: 5046×84=200368\frac{50}{46} \times \frac{8}{4} = \frac{200}{368}

Let's Simplify 200368\frac{200}{368}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 200200 and 368368. The GCD of 200200 and 368368 is 88.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:200÷8368÷8=2546\frac{200 \div 8}{368 \div 8} = \frac{25}{46}

Answer 5046÷84=2546\frac{50}{46}\div\frac{8}{4} = \frac{25}{46}
